    Have you checked the axles of the front wheels for lint or hair ? It doesn’t take much rubbish on the axle to start causing a problem with steering. Do both front wheels spin freely and spin the same amount ?

    I have the Inital D setand I have changed the antenna on the car. I changed the factory antenna to a 120 mm dual twisted wire one fabricated from phone cable. Unfortunately, in my haste to start modding,I did not measure the range prior to the mod, but I currently get about 7.5 metres.

    Ijust bought a 40MHz Skyline yesterday and, out of the box, it was getting 7.5 – 8 metres.

    Both of these measurements are inside the house. I have yet to test it outside to see whether there is a difference or not.

    Thanks Panda – I sorted it! You were right, it was the controller all along! You see, I did have another 47MHz controller but the aerial was stuck in the wound position – I couldn’t pull the aerial out. So I thought ‘doesn’t really matter, I’ve got the 47MHz controller that came with the Supra anyhow’. After racking my brains trying to get the Supra’s range up, and after reading your post, I thought its got to be worth me fixing that faulty 47MHz controller. So I did! And hey presto – good range :smiley1:
